With two stakes-winners on his resume already, Golden Slipper winning sire Stay Inside couldn’t be doing much more and Sledmere Stud were well rewarded when they sold one of his fillies at Magic Millions on Friday for $750,000.
The highest price so far at this sale for her sire, the powerful chestnut is the first living foal of metro winning So You Think mare Ruru, a half-sister to outstanding dual Group I winning filly She’s Extreme, who is by Stay Inside’s sire Extreme Choice.

The filly was knocked down to MyRacehorse Pty Ltd/Belmont Bloodstock Agency (FBAA)/AWB and has pedigree to back up her good looks with Belmont Bloodstock’s Damon Gabbedy also impressed with her action.
“It is a much used phrase but she had a huge walk. As loose as a goose. She was a machine, I thought,” he said.
“She has the biggest overstep on the complex, I thought. Great mover, great temperament and just loved her.
“We had to pay way too much. We didn’t think she’s cost that much coming into it but she was such a standout that there was plenty of competition.”
MyRacehorse have already enjoyed success with this sireline as their colours are carried by Group I winning filly Apocaylptic, who is by Stay Inside’s sire Extreme Choice.
Ruru produced a colt last spring by Stay Inside and was then covered by another Golden Slipper winner in Farnan.
